UNHRC Side-event by EFSAS on "Human Rights in South Asia" - 26 September 2022

 

During the 51st Session of the UNHRC, the European Foundation for South Asian Studies (EFSAS) in collaboration with its Partner organization, The Organization for Poverty Alleviation and Development (OPAD), will be organizing a Side-event on the Human Rights situation in South Asia on 26 September 2022 at 09:00 (CET). 

The title of the Webinar is: 'Human Rights situation in South Asia'. A group of international experts will present their views and deliberate upon this topic and discuss the effects of terrorism on human rights in the region.  

The session will be moderated by Mr. Junaid Qureshi - Director EFSAS. 

 

The Speakers will include: 

  • Malaiz Daud - political analyst, formerly Chief of Staff of Afghanistan’s former President (Mr. Ashraf Ghani), Research Fellow at Barcelona Centre for International Affairs and Research Fellow at EFSAS.

  • Bashir Ahmad Gwakh - Author, Journalist at Radio Free Europe and an expert on Terrorism, Afghan Media, Taliban, TTP and ISKP.

  • Fazal Khan - Advocate, Human Rights Activist and member of the Pashtun Tahafuz Movement (PTM).
